We have faith that the USA will persevere despite Comrade Donald Trump being sworn in as President today. After a mostly positive eight years, celebs took to Twitter to thank Barack Obama for his service.
There was never any doubt that Obama was #fortheculture. Rappers, singers, actors and media personalities have all been expressing their gratitude for the first Black President.
See who offered their praise below and on the following pages, starting with Kendrick Lamar (note Obama is now at @POTUS44 be sure you update accordingly).
